Original Marathi from the Tukaram Gatha
मराठी मूळ
सन्मुख चि तुह्मीं सांगावी जी सेवा । ऐसे माझे देवा मनोरथ ॥1॥
निघों आह्मी कांहीं चित्तवित्त घरें । आपुल्या उदारें जीवावरी ॥ध्रु.॥
बोल परस्परें वाढवावें सुख । पाहावें श्रीमुख डोळेभरी ॥2॥
तुका ह्मणे सत्य बोलतों वचन । करुनी चरण साक्ष तुझे ॥3॥

English Translation
May You command Your service to me face to face, O Lord; such is the desire of my heart. I will give away my mind, my wealth, my home, and my very life for Your sake. Let us exchange words that increase our mutual joy, and let me gaze at Your blessed face to my heart's content. Says Tuka, I speak this as a true vow, with Your feet as my witness.
